We are proud to be sponsors of the UK Evaluation Society conference, which will be held in May 2025 in the vibrant city of Glasgow. 

The 2025 conference focuses on the vital role of data in delivering impactful evaluations that drive positive change. 

The five core themes of the conference are: 

  1. Exploring data types: Exploring rich and diverse sources of data, including surveys, experimental designs, numbers, words, images, attitudes, perceptions, behaviours, interviews, observations, case studies, and focus groups, document reviews, big data, and administrative data.
  2. Leveraging data (methodologies): Examining qualitative and quantitative approaches, triangulation and mixed methods, impact and process, alongside innovative and traditional methods.
  3. Data innovation and evaluation stages: Looking at infrastructure from commissioning to analysis, collecting and reporting data, monitoring/administrative data, data dashboards, and the pros and cons of AI data analysis.
  4. Data in context: Transforming raw data into meaningful insights, crafting reports, narratives and case studies to bring data to life, tackling the challenge of reporting timelines and reflective evaluation in a fast-moving environment, and implementing changes for continuous improvement.
  5. Data Integrity and ethics: Whose data is it anyway and what's your bias? Including data standards and processes, privacy, and data misuse.

The 2025 conference promises to shine a light on data - from numbers to narratives - illuminating unique insights, new techniques, and delving into what the future holds for evaluation in an increasingly data-driven world.
